On-draught @ the brewery as part of a flight.

The blueberry is subtle and unfortunately not entirely authentic.

A decently balanced little blonde ale. Mosaic hops might accentuate the blueberry, as might switching to actual blueberries and/or bilberries if they're cheating it with blueberry puree as I suspect.
